It may be widespread knowledge that baby wipes do a great job on everyday tasks like dusting and cleaning spills. Did you know they do wonders getting grime off old furniture?

Eureka!

One day I was cleaning in my son's room and grabbed a baby wipe to get some dusting done. As I started rubbing some of the darker stains on his chair, I saw the dark residue was coming clean. I thought little of it, but made a mental memo to get the appropriate cleaner later.

Wipes Work Better than Store-Bought Cleaner

After a ride to the home improvement store, I returned with a cleaner made to remove old residue from furniture. I used the store-bought cleaner, but was let down to see the stains were not coming off, even with intense scrubbing. So I tried the baby wipes again and was so overwhelmed with the results, I had to take some pictures to share.

The usefulness of baby wipes is endless. I cannot tell you if other brands work well, but I was using Huggies Natural Care. They are the only product I found that removes mother's milk stains from my floor; and now, look at this, they restore old furniture!
